Sapa Private Scooter Rice Terrace Tours Led By Women
Sapa’s rice terraces are spread across an extraordinary mountain landscape, appearing on steep hillsides, around farming communities, and above peaceful valleys. Sapa Private Scooter Rice Terrace Tours Led By Women is a private full-day experience for travelers who want to explore these landscapes from the road, traveling with a Vietnamese female scooter rider and English-speaking guide. The journey is designed around the changing scenery between mountain communities rather than simply stopping at one famous viewpoint.
For this version, the route follows a new order through Ta Giang Phinh Valley, Sao Chua, Hau Thao, Ban Khoang, and Ta Phin, with countryside lunch in Part 4. The day combines rice terraces, high mountain roads, agricultural valleys, forests, waterfalls, village culture, photography, and relaxed countryside travel.

Sapa Private Scooter Rice Terrace Tours Led By Women Itinerary
🟢 Part 1: Ta Giang Phinh Valley – Rice Fields & Mountain Surroundings
Your private scooter journey begins at 8:30 AM with pickup from your hotel in Sapa. Meet your Vietnamese female scooter rider and English-speaking guide before leaving town and heading toward Ta Giang Phinh Valley.
As you move farther from Sapa, the scenery becomes increasingly rural. Mountain roads pass through farms, gardens, streams, traditional houses, and cultivated fields before opening into the broad valley.
Ta Giang Phinh offers an excellent first introduction to the agricultural side of Sapa. Rice fields spread across the valley while imposing mountains rise around them.
Depending on the season, the landscape may be covered in fresh green rice, golden crops during harvest, or newly prepared fields. Stop along the countryside roads for photographs and enjoy the peaceful surroundings.
The valley also gives you the chance to observe how farming communities use the land between the surrounding mountains before continuing toward the higher roads of Sao Chua.
🟢 Part 2: Sao Chua – Elevated Rice Terraces & Wide Mountain Views
From Ta Giang Phinh, the scooter route climbs toward Sao Chua, where the landscape becomes increasingly elevated.
The road winds through mountain slopes and opens onto impressive views of terraced hillsides, valleys, forests, and distant peaks.
Here, the rice terraces can be appreciated from above, showing how entire mountain slopes have been shaped for cultivation. The changing elevation creates different perspectives at almost every turn.
This section is particularly rewarding for photography. Stop at scenic points where terraces stretch across the mountains and clouds or mist move between the peaks.
Your guide can explain how rice cultivation is adapted to steep terrain and changing weather conditions.
After exploring the high mountain scenery, continue toward Hau Thao.
🟢 Part 3: Hau Thao – Terraced Hills & Village Countryside
The route continues through Hau Thao, where the rice terraces become closely connected with farms and village life.
Ride along quieter roads bordered by cultivated slopes, gardens, homes, and agricultural land. The landscape provides a more intimate view of how the terraces fit into everyday mountain life.
Rather than simply photographing the fields from a distant lookout, you travel beside them and see the roads, homes, farms, and valleys that surround the terraces.
There are several opportunities to stop for photographs and enjoy panoramic views across the mountain landscape.
The combination of village scenery and terraced hills makes Hau Thao an important part of the morning before taking a break for lunch.
🟢 Part 4: Countryside Lunch – A Relaxing Mountain Break
Around midday, pause for a Vietnamese countryside lunch.
After the morning ride through Ta Giang Phinh, Sao Chua, and Hau Thao, enjoy a relaxing meal surrounded by mountain scenery.
Depending on the day’s menu, lunch may include steamed rice, vegetables, chicken, pork, mushrooms, herbs, and other Vietnamese dishes.
This is a chance to sit down, recharge, and enjoy the peaceful countryside before continuing the afternoon journey.
Keeping lunch in Part 4 gives the itinerary a comfortable rhythm, with the first half centered around rice terraces and mountain agriculture and the afternoon introducing forests, waterfalls, and ethnic village culture.
🟢 Part 5: Ban Khoang – Forest Roads, Streams & Waterfalls
After lunch, leave the open terrace landscapes behind and continue toward Ban Khoang.
The environment gradually becomes greener, with forested slopes, streams, farmland, gardens, and scattered homes lining the winding mountain roads.
Where conditions allow, stop beside a waterfall or mountain stream for photographs and a short rest.
This section creates a strong contrast with the morning’s wide rice-terrace panoramas. Instead of open cultivated mountainsides, the route now passes through dense vegetation and quieter forest scenery.
The ride through Ban Khoang also provides opportunities to observe mountain agriculture and communities living among the forested hills.
From Ban Khoang, continue toward Ta Phin for the final cultural experience.
🟢 Part 6: Ta Phin – Red Dao Culture & Scenic Return to Sapa
The final stop is Ta Phin, a mountain village associated with the Red Dao community.
Take time to explore the village surroundings and discover aspects of Red Dao culture, including traditional clothing, embroidery, handicrafts, homes, gardens, and agricultural life.
Your English-speaking guide can explain the cultural traditions behind the distinctive clothing and handmade textiles while you explore the peaceful village environment.
Ta Phin provides a fitting conclusion to the journey because the tour moves from rice-growing landscapes into forests and finally finishes with an opportunity to discover the people and culture of the mountains.
After the village visit, return to the scooter and begin the scenic ride back toward Sapa.
Arrive at approximately 4:30 PM, completing a full day of rice terraces, valleys, mountain roads, forests, waterfalls, village culture, and countryside scenery.
